Christopher Columbus George was born in 1837 in Washington, Cambria County, Pennsylvania, USA, the child of Phillip Dishong George And Rebecca J Pittman. In 1850, Christopher Columbus George resided in Washington, Cambria, Pennsylvania, USA. In 1870, Christopher Columbus George resided in Washington, Cambria, Pennsylvania, USA. Christopher Columbus George married Mary L, and had children including Bertha Francis George, Charles Albert George, Ellen A George, Frances Alberta George, Henrietta Elizabeth George, Ida Grace George, John Lee George, Nancy Melvina George, Philip Houston George. Christopher Columbus George passed away in 1912 in Lilly, Cambria County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
